Output 108b124f7481dfc8990785395be448e934982efd6f825b33a0a66e37c674a5f0: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35cdfb35470da96f6b78c19c88f3f01521a883f5 OP_EQUAL
address
36bWVYLb2ambX3yH6crwHaH1NfAjoNDL7e
transaction
108b124f7481dfc8990785395be448e934982efd6f825b33a0a66e37c674a5f0
spent
true